Output 38c7f26f695f6f1d9cea41cb89fe809385dbebd5c23830f598da379a9bfdfec3:1

value
6599909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 935d6047564424abf9859f9f66d21a7fa2e68a73 OP_EQUALVERIFY OP_CHECKSIG
address
1ESCC5qhYL3bWHmNvacy3Mjcvt85iPKSvR
transaction
38c7f26f695f6f1d9cea41cb89fe809385dbebd5c23830f598da379a9bfdfec3
spent
true